In Research in Engineering and Computer Science II, students continue to gather and analyze experimental data or complete their design project based on their previous trimester work. In June 2019, NCSSM broke ground on a second residential campus in Morganton, funded by $58 million approved by voters in the Connect NC bond package, $15 million appropriated by the NC General Assembly, and at least $10 million being raised privately. These programs are rigorous, competitive, and rewarding. Students are required to present their results at the NCSSM Research Symposium in the spring and are encouraged to present their research at the North Carolina Student Academy of Science competition and other competitions.
